    If you are interested in an new experience , permaculture, with hard manual help an off grid lifestyle.fresh veggies from the orchard chickens and eggs, from the yard.
    no chemicals or fertilizers are used, only fully organic compost which is made by the resident chickens and neighbors cow manure
    When egg laying hens are about 12 months old commercial farms turn them into cat food since they have passed their prime
    I normally buy around a thousand and redistribute throughout the community thus allowing them to live out their lives
    It is amazing to watch their reactions when they first experience the sun on their feathers To see them actually scratching the dirt and eat their first worm
    Keeping them safe is a major obstacle as foxes falcons and many other predators enjoy the free supermarket
    We will also concentrate in planting trees so we can play our part in helping Mother Nature’s lungs We use well water and our own harvested wood for water and ambient heating. for 9 months of the year we also use a wood burning "potage'" for cooking.
    during summer, helpers that wish to de toxify , are welcomed to partake in the juicing diet, using our organically grown veggies.
    ..and if you are serious, you can have your own patch of land, grow your own produce and be
    creative.
    We are also producing our own fruit wine, vinegar,medicinal herbs and dehydrating or fruit/veggies.

    Cultural exchange and learning opportunities

    there are stunning mountains and lakes close to us.
    oropa is a world known pilgrimage sanctuary that venerates a black virgin mary. it has beautiful trails, cable car to lake mucrone and monte camino. it is only a local bus ride from biella.
    pie di cavallo is an ancient mountain village, worth a visit and also a local bus ride from biella
    lake viverone is a 45 min. walk from the cascina(or you can catch a rare bus)
